Я новичок в bash сценариях, и я пытаюсь заставить это работать:
Сканирование диапазона IP для поиска устройств с открытым портом 80... Я думаю, что это должно выглядеть так:
#!/bin/bash
echo -----------------------------------
for ip in 192.168.0.{1,.255}; do
nmap -p80 192.168.0.1
if #open; then
echo "{ip} has the port 80 open"
else
#do nothing
fi
done
echo -----------------------------------
exit 0
Я также хочу увидеть результаты следующим образом:
-----------------------------------
192.168.0.1 has the port 80 open
192.168.0.10 has the port 80 open
192.168.0.13 has the port 80 open
192.168.0.15 has the port 80 open
-----------------------------------
(Итак, без ошибок или nmap
нормальных выходов..)
Может кто-нибудь мне помочь?